What Are Bed Bugs?
Bed bugs are small, brown insects that feed on human blood. They are often found in mattresses, bed frames, and other areas where people sleep. Bed bugs are not known to transmit diseases, but their bites can be itchy and uncomfortable.
How to Identify Bed Bugs
Bed bugs are small, flat insects that are about the size of an apple seed. They are brown in color and have six legs. Bed bugs are often found in clusters and may be visible to the naked eye.

Tips:
- Be sure to vacuum your mattress and bed frame regularly to remove any bed bugs or eggs.
- Wash your bedding in hot water and dry it on high heat to kill any bed bugs that may be present.
- If you have a severe bed bug infestation, you may need to call a professional exterminator.
